Estabelecer Conexão com o JDBC Thin Driver
O Autonomous Database exige uma conexão segura que use o TLSv1.2 (Transport Layer Security).
Os aplicativos Java que usam o driver JDBC Thin se conectam com um dos seguintes:
-
Autenticação mTLS (TLS mútuo): requer o Oracle Wallet ou o Java KeyStore (JKS) em que o cliente e o Autonomous Database se autenticam.
Os arquivos da wallet e do armazenamento de chaves são incluídos no arquivo
.zip
de credenciais do cliente que está disponível clicando em Conexão do banco de dados na Console do Oracle Cloud Infrastructure -
Autenticação TLS: O computador cliente corresponde ao certificado raiz da CA do servidor à lista de CAs confiáveis do cliente. Se a CA emissora for confiável, o cliente verificará se o certificado é autêntico. Isso permite que o cliente e o Autonomous Database estabeleçam a conexão criptografada antes de trocar qualquer mensagem.
Consulte Estabelecendo Conexão com o Oracle Database Manualmente para obter informações adicionais sobre como conectar seus aplicativos Java ao Autonomous Database usando o driver JDBC da Oracle e o Universal Connection Pool.
Tópicos
- Conexões Finas JDBC com uma Wallet (mTLS)
O Autonomous Database exige uma conexão segura que use a TLSv1.2 (Transport Layer Security). Dependendo das opções de configuração de rede, o Autonomous Database suporta autenticação mTLS e TLS. - Conexões Finas JDBC sem uma Wallet (TLS)
O Autonomous Database exige uma conexão segura que use o TLSv1.2 (Transport Layer Security). Dependendo das opções de configuração, o Autonomous Database suporta autenticação mTLS e TLS. Esta seção aborda o uso de Conexões JDBC Thin com autenticação TLS sem uma wallet.
Tópico principal: Estabelecer Conexão com o Autonomous Database